Recognizing an Eye Emergency: Red Flags to Watch For

Sudden Vision Loss or Blurring

If your vision slips away or becomes hazy within minutes, call emergency services immediately. This could indicate a retinal detachment, stroke, or severe infection.

Painful Injury or Foreign Object Insertion

Any sharp pain, burning sensation, or a feeling of something stuck in the eye demands urgent evaluation. Even a small particle can cause serious damage.

Intense Redness and Swelling

Excessive redness, especially if accompanied by discharge or swelling, may point to conjunctivitis, corneal ulcers, or ocular trauma.

Flash of Light or Floaters

Seeing sudden flashes or floaters can signal retinal detachment or hemorrhage. Seek help right away.

Key Features of a Quality Emergency Eye Care Facility

Modern emergency eye care facility interior with advanced diagnostic equipment

Feature Why It Matters
24/7 Availability Eye emergencies can happen at any hour.
Qualified Ophthalmologists Specialized training ensures accurate diagnosis.
Advanced Imaging Tools like OCT and fundus photography detect subtle issues.
Same‑Day Treatment Immediate care reduces risk of permanent damage.
Insurance Compatibility Reduces out‑of‑pocket costs.
Clear Communication Helps patients understand prognosis and next steps.

Expert Tips for Quick and Effective Eye Emergency Care

  1. Call 911 if you experience sudden loss of vision or severe pain that may indicate a stroke.
  2. Do not rub or touch the affected eye; this can worsen injury.
  3. Use a clean cloth or paper towel to gently remove any debris.
  4. Apply a cool compress to reduce swelling and discomfort.
  5. Ask the provider to explain each diagnostic step.
  6. Follow up with an ophthalmologist within 24 hours, even if symptoms improve.
  7. Keep a medical log of symptoms and treatments for future reference.
  8. Share your record with any new doctor to avoid duplicate tests.
